Hyperoxia causes miR-34a-mediated injury via angiopoietin-1 in neonatal lungs
Hyperoxia-induced acute lung injury (HALI) is a key contributor to the pathogenesis of bronchopulmonary dysplasia (BPD) in neonates, for which no specific preventive or therapeutic agent is available.
